Component: IS-A-DBM
Component Name: Dealer Business Management
Description: An internal order that is generated automatically for the purpose of gathering all the information on costs and revenue that have been incurred during a vehicle service. Exactly one header internal order is generated for each service order. The header internal order collects the costs for the service orders that have not yet been invoiced. These then form the "work in process".
